Baomin Wang has authored 93 papers that have received a total of 2.3k indexed citations.
This includes 37 papers in Molecular Biology, 37 papers in Plant Science and 14 papers in Public Health, Environmental and Occupational Health. The topics of these papers are Pharmaceutical Quality and Counterfeiting (11 papers), Pesticide Residue Analysis and Safety (10 papers) and Plant Molecular Biology Research (9 papers). Baomin Wang is often cited by papers focused on Pharmaceutical Quality and Counterfeiting (11 papers), Pesticide Residue Analysis and Safety (10 papers) and Plant Molecular Biology Research (9 papers) and collaborates with scholars based in China, United States and Myanmar. Baomin Wang's co-authors include Zhaohu Li, Guiyu Tan, Qing X. Li, Tiegui Nan and Yongliang Cui and has published in prestigious journals such as PLoS ONE, Analytical Chemistry and Journal of Virology.
